Bartram’s Mile: Design Workshop

November 10, 2012 @ 7:00 am - 10:00 am

Join us for an engaging design workshop and find out more about an exciting project that is underway to convert one mile of currently vacant riverfront property into public green space! Your input is essential to this project and will help the City of Philadelphia create a vibrant public space to be enjoyed for years to come.

This project is currently being referred to as “Bartram’s Mile” and several partners are involved: Philadelphia Parks and Recreation, the Schuylkill River Development Corporation (SRDC) and the John Bartram Association. A series of public events and meetings will be convened over the next few months by PennPraxis.
